SchemaEntityClasses
CBasePropDoor
CBasePropDoor
Inheritance: CDynamicProp
Fields
- m_flAutoReturnDelay float
- m_hDoorList CUtlVector<CHandle<CBasePropDoor>>
- m_nHardwareType int32_t
- m_bNeedsHardware bool
- m_eDoorState DoorState_t
- m_bLocked bool
- m_bNoNPCs bool
- m_closedPosition Vector
- m_closedAngles QAngle
- m_hBlocker CHandle<CBaseEntity>
- m_bFirstBlocked bool
- m_ls [locksound_t](/docs/schema/entity/classes/locksound_t)
- m_bForceClosed bool
- m_vecLatchWorldPosition Vector
- m_hActivator CHandle<CBaseEntity>
- m_SoundMoving CUtlSymbolLarge
- m_SoundOpen CUtlSymbolLarge
- m_SoundClose CUtlSymbolLarge
- m_SoundLock CUtlSymbolLarge
- m_SoundUnlock CUtlSymbolLarge
- m_SoundLatch CUtlSymbolLarge
- m_SoundPound CUtlSymbolLarge
- m_SoundJiggle CUtlSymbolLarge
- m_SoundLockedAnim CUtlSymbolLarge
- m_numCloseAttempts int32_t
- m_nPhysicsMaterial CUtlStringToken
- m_SlaveName CUtlSymbolLarge
- m_hMaster CHandle<CBasePropDoor>
- m_OnBlockedClosing [CEntityIOOutput](/docs/schema/Entityio)
- m_OnBlockedOpening [CEntityIOOutput](/docs/schema/Entityio)
- m_OnUnblockedClosing [CEntityIOOutput](/docs/schema/Entityio)
- m_OnUnblockedOpening [CEntityIOOutput](/docs/schema/Entityio)
- m_OnFullyClosed [CEntityIOOutput](/docs/schema/Entityio)
- m_OnFullyOpen [CEntityIOOutput](/docs/schema/Entityio)
- m_OnClose [CEntityIOOutput](/docs/schema/Entityio)
- m_OnOpen [CEntityIOOutput](/docs/schema/Entityio)
- m_OnLockedUse [CEntityIOOutput](/docs/schema/Entityio)
- m_OnAjarOpen [CEntityIOOutput](/docs/schema/Entityio)
Methods
FromIndex()
Parameters
- index.Get()